DUELLIST OFFERS PEACE.
TO CELEBRATE BIRTH OF DAUGHTER. Dr. Francis Sarga, who challenged nine men to duels, has offered, in the spirit of Christmas and to celebrate the birth of his first-born (a daughter), to forgive his traducers and withdraw ths remaining duelling challenges if apologies are offered, according to a cable message from Budapest in the Sydney “Sun.” He says the baby is a marvellous Christmas present, and is “just like me, with black eyes and hair.” Madame Sarga says she is glad the baby is not a boy, as he might have been a duellist. Dr. Sarga fought two of the duels, winning one, while the other was inconclusive.
